确定视频的未压缩比特率

时间:2014-11-24 06:46:26

标签: video h.264 bitrate handbrake preset

最近,我尝试使用以下手刹设置对默认的Windows 7 Wildlife示例视频进行编码:http://i.stack.imgur.com/GQhQv.png

我这样做了三次,唯一不同的是x264 Preset,我在Ultrafast,Medium和Placebo设置了它。当然,因为Ultrafast编码在以无损耗方式压缩视频方面做得更糟糕,它必须在无损压缩之前降低视频比特率以符合设置的1000kbps比特率最后的视频。 Medium和Placebo可以提供更高的未压缩比特率,因此看起来好多了,如下所示:http://i.stack.imgur.com/YPmV8.png

我面临的问题是,从上面显示的MediaInfo详细信息来看,除了重构之外,根本不存在文件之间的巨大差异,我怀疑他们可以对视频的质量产生如此大的影响(虽然可以随意证明我的错误)。

所以我想知道,因为所有视频似乎都具有相同的压缩后比特率,你是如何在不自己查看视频的情况下确定视频的实际质量的?有没有一个工具可以让你查看未压缩的比特率?

1 个答案:

答案 0 :(得分:0)

未压缩比特率是每像素宽*高*比特。 YUV420p的bbp为12,(视频中最常见的颜色格式)。所有三个最终视频都具有相同的比特率。

比特率是无用的质量衡量标准。最好的衡量标准是观看视频(主观测试)。像PSNR和SSIM这样的客观测试不太准确,可以实现自动化。

速度设置的不同之处在于编码器每个阶段花费的时间。例如,编码处理的运动补偿步骤。基本上,在先前帧中搜索与当前帧类似的数据。如果找到,则不是将像素编码到当前帧中,而是参考前一帧中的像素。这意味着可以使用更少的比特来编码当前帧。你花费的时间越多,你会发现匹配得越好。因此,以相同的比特率提高CPU的质量。